Advisors Asset Management Inc. lifted its holdings in Acadia Realty Trust (NYSE:AKR – Free Report) by 5.3% in the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The fund owned 123,277 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after buying an additional 6,253 shares during the quarter. Advisors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in Acadia Realty Trust were worth $2,978,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Acadia Realty Trust Increases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, April 15th. Investors of record on Monday, March 31st will be given a dividend of $0.20 per share. This represents a $0.80 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.79%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, March 31st. This is an increase from Acadia Realty Trust’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.19. Acadia Realty Trust’s dividend payout ratio is currently 444.44%.

Acadia Realty Trust Company Profile
Acadia Realty Trust is an equity real estate investment trust focused on delivering long-term, profitable growth via its dual Core Portfolio and Fund operating platforms and its disciplined, location-driven investment strategy. Acadia Realty Trust is accomplishing this goal by building a best-in-class core real estate portfolio with meaningful concentrations of assets in the nation's most dynamic corridors; making profitable opportunistic and value-add investments through its series of discretionary, institutional funds; and maintaining a strong balance sheet.
